Stable Dividend: SNN's dividends per share have been stable in the past 10 years.
Growing Dividend: SNN's dividend payments have increased over the past 10 years.

Notable Dividend: SNN's dividend (3.03%) is higher than the bottom 25% of dividend payers in the US market (1.55%).
High Dividend: SNN's dividend (3.03%) is low compared to the top 25% of dividend payers in the US market (4.78%).
Earnings Payout to Shareholders
Earnings Coverage: With its high payout ratio (124.2%), SNN's dividend payments are not well covered by earnings.
Cash Payout to Shareholders
Cash Flow Coverage: With its high cash payout ratio (180.6%), SNN's dividend payments are not well covered by cash flows.
